Tailor Your Launchers to Your Exact Workflow

The core strength of the Main Menu desktop editor lies in its deep customization capabilities. Instead of manually editing configuration files in a terminal, you can modify almost every aspect of your application shortcuts visually. Here is what you can accomplish with this versatile utility:

  • Visual Personalization: Set launcher icons to specific files or search through your active icon-theme to find the perfect match. You can also change launcher names, add descriptive comments, and create custom search keywords.
  • Advanced Execution Controls: Define specific commands or files for launchers to execute, set custom working directories, and even force applications to open in a terminal window or utilize a more powerful discrete GPU.
  • Smart Web Integration: Quickly convert your favorite web links into valid system commands to access web apps directly from your desktop menu.
  • Desktop Visibility Management: Choose to show or hide specific launchers in your main menu, or restrict their visibility to certain desktop environments. You can easily adjust categories or create duplicates for different workflows.

Flexible .desktop File Handling

Power users will appreciate how seamlessly the Main Menu desktop editor interacts with the underlying system. You can open existing .desktop files using the app's internal menu, your system file manager, or simply by dragging and dropping them into the interface. Once modified, you can install them directly to your desktop environment's application menu or export them to custom locations for backup and deployment. If you ever make a mistake, the software features a built-in safety net that lets you instantly reset launchers back to their original states.
